Hello, I have a small problem with variable scope. I would like to declare a variable and store the "Cleared" action in the <for-each> iteration, and then I have to access it again after the loop ends (It would be even more nice if I could break the loop on encountering the 'Cleared' text) to do some processing based on the status of the action. Can anyone help me with this?
